ICT Showcase - some statistics

The Enterprise Ireland's ICT Showcase event on the 6th October 2008 has been a success. Ten very high quality close-to-market technologies were presented. Commercialisation opportunities from 9 top Irish research institutions were demonstrated. 11 posters describing the state-of-the-art applied researches were exhibited. There were more than 170 attendees. Many were coming from the VC/investor communities. 41 entrepreneurs attended and some were probably looking for new opportunities.

Large-scale Wireless Sensor Network Architecture

This a Poster that has been presented in Enterprise Ireland ICT Showcase 2008.

It summarizes the technology being developed in SUMAC (an EI-funded project) with both its technological innovations and commercial aspects.

The objective of this project is to render WSN as easy to use as possible, by making them easy to deploy, easy to operate, and easy to leverage without requiring particular technical skills.

A start in bringing the Irish ICT research Community & Irish Industry together online

Having run the Annual Commercialisation Showcase in conjunction with Enterprise Ireland’s ICT Commercialisation unit for successive years Zircol.com (aka investnet ltd) became conscious of the need to bring industry and high quality research projects together the year round.

So we setup a Social network for it.
